Here's why I think I couldn't find my false chord

7 Upvotes

Other than improper training/techniques, of course.

I'm only speculating...

All this time I've only been listening to up beat / fast / angry metal songs. So when I tried to scream along to these songs, I worry more about pronouncing the next words correctly/with the same amount of energy instead of actually producing the false chord sound.

And then today, I tried working on a metal song for a band audition. Their genre is probably a little different than what I'm usually listening to. Much slower / darker / more dramatic.

And I just brainstormed some random screaming patterns, without lyrics yet. I recorded it of course. And wow, I mean, I sound good I think, in my opinion. 😁

When you hit false chord, it is HARD to pronounce words properly.

So I had been focusing on the wrong part of screaming.
